AN Olympic champion inspired children at their sports day.

Children at St Catharine's Primary School, Chipping Campden, welcomed Olympic gold medallist Matt Gotrel MBE to their annual sports day.

Mr Gotrel a former pupil of the school, who claimed gold with the men's eight coxed rowing squad at the Rio Olympics in 2016, joined parents as they cheered the children on in an array of field and track events.

The children took on their challenges in an emphatic fashion to secure those essential points for their respective houses: Dunstan, Chad, Bede and Beckett.

Bede lead the teams at the end of the sprint track events, but surging ahead with star performances on the field and year 6 teams’ 800m track events, Dunstan were announced 2017 house champions with 2989 points.

Anita Dee, acting head teacher, said: “It’s been a wonderful sports event, enjoyed by the children and parents. We were thrilled to welcome Matt back to St Catharine’s to help inspire our students.

"Judging by the children’s sprinting, throwing and jumping achievements there is great potential for another St Catharine’s pupil to follow in Matt’s Olympic title winning footsteps.”
